The best watches for Extreme Sports

If you’re the sort of person who likes to spend their time traversing the wilds, exploring the oceans and experiencing everything the outdoors has to offer, you’re going to need a watch that is functional, lightweight, durable and athletic.

Thankfully, we’ve got the right timepieces to suit your lifestyle, and while these watches might be highly technical and built to withstand the elements, they’re also incredibly stylish. This means that you’ll always look your best, regardless of which outdoor pursuit you’re getting involved in. From classic Rolex watches to modern Rado timepieces, these are the best models on the market for extreme sports aficionados:

1) Rolex Submariner

Rolex watches are incredibly collectable and highly sought-after. As the world’s premium luxury watch manufacturer, you can expect engineering prowess and style in equal measure. For those with a keen interest in diving, the Rolex Submariner is the ideal choice. Entry-level models start at approximately £5,000 and generally offer water resistance for 300 metres of depth. Higher-end models, such as the Rolex Submariner Deepsea, can even offer resistances of over 10,000 metres!

As standard, Rolex Submariner watches feature a unidirectional bezel to prevent dive time miscalculation, luminescent markers for easy legibility underwater, and precision engineering you can rely on.

2) Breitling Windrider Chronomat GMT

The Windrider Chronomat is one of those rare Breitling watches that combines chronograph capability with a functional dual-time system. It’s a bold, practical and useful timepiece that is distinguished by a rotating bezel which allows for 24-hour third timezone reading. This is particularly useful for sailors who might need to time their arrival in a far-flung destination.

However, the Windrider Chronomat GMT is suited to a variety of outdoor pursuits. It features a classic-shaped band, is comfortable on the wrist and durable enough to withstand shocks and bumps experienced while running or hiking.

3) Omega Seamaster

Omega watches are a great choice for those who want a combination of traditional design and rugged engineering. The Seamaster is perfect for scuba diving and can withstand depths of up to 30 metres for two hours at a time. With a scratch-resistant crystal, this certified chronometer is easily legible in all conditions and won’t damage easily.

4) Oris Williams Chronograph Carbon Fibre Extreme

Oris watches have long been associated with motorsports. While some motor-inspired watches can look flashy, crass or aggressive, Oris instead opts for balance and composure. With lightweight materials, a conservative colour scheme and certified accuracy, this watch will really strike a chord among fans of extreme sports.

It’s also incredibly comfortable to wear, making it perfect for those with active lifestyles. The carbon fibre case is particularly attractive in natural sunlight; another great reason for wearing this watch outdoors.

5) Rado HyperChrome

For those who want a great all-rounder timepiece, Rado watches come highly recommended. The Rado HyperChrome chronograph is beautifully crafted from premium materials and is as perfectly at home during formal occasions as it is out in the wild.

This model is water-resistant up to 50 metres and features a ceramic bezel that features a tachymeter scale. Legibility will never be a concern, as the dial is protected by a scratch-resistant crystal, and SuperLumi-Nova coatings on the hour markers and hands make reading the time easy, even in the dark, under the ocean or in inclement weather conditions.
